It's someone else's idea from the Command thread. You could try this for multiple corpses:

Target Nearest Object / Use Targeted Object
Delay
Target Next Object / Use Targeted Object
Delay
Target Next Object / Use Targeted Object
Delay
Target Next Object / Use Targeted Object
Delay
Target Next Object / Use Targeted Object

Adjust the delay for your individual setup. This uses the 5 nearest objects but, as you say, you will need to wait for the blood to decay.
